Is Super Saiyan 4 Goku Now Canon in Dragon Ball?
Any appearances of Super Saiyan 4 in Dragon Ball thus far have been in Dragon Ball GT, an anime-only sequel not penned by the creator of the series, hence it is categorized as a non-canonical side story. The present canon timeline proceeds from Dragon Ball Z to Dragon Ball Super with the Dragon Ball Super movies, none of which make any mention of Super Saiyan 4. In contrast to declaring the non-canon Super Saiyan 4 as a legitimate transformation, Dragon Ball Super went ahead to introduce Super Saiyan God, Super Saiyan Blue, and Ultra Instinct.
Dragon Ball DAIMA was penned by Akira Toriyama himself and is set chronologically after the events of the Buu Saga of Dragon Ball Z and before the onset of Dragon Ball Super. More specifically, it takes place in the year of Age 775, exactly one year after the defeat of Kid Buu (Age 774) and three years before the events of Dragon Ball Super begin (Age 778). If nothing was to come up, that means the form should have been introduced into the later events, most notably the Tournament of Power.
But then it leaves room for possible in-universe reasons for the absence. Perhaps it is a temporary power-up that Goku loses, or it might have specific conditions to activate it, for example, being exclusive to the Demon Realm. While the episode did not release any explicit hints in that regard, Neva (the Namekian from the Demon Realm’s Namek who is the creator and guardian of the Demon Realm Dragon Balls) did make it possible for Goku to transform. Most likely, they will go back to normal from next week, and there will not even be a need to transform again.
In any case: Yes, Super Saiyan 4 Goku can now be considered canon because the form appeared in a Dragon Ball story that was written by the original creator Akira Toriyama.
About Dragon Ball DAIMA
The series has been animated by Toei Animation until February 28. Directed by Yoshitaka Yashima and Aya Komaki, the series composition and scenario are handled by Yuko Kakihara and animation character design is handled by Katsuyoshi Nakatsuru. The late Akira Toriyama was meanwhile in charge for the story of the Dragon Ball DAIMA anime. Watch the recently released climax trailer below.
